Run with It: Sanity on the Treadmill

February 22, 2022 • 3 Comments

If you’re anything like me, you probably dread the treadmill. It can be so difficult to stay sane when you’re going nowhere and staring at the same scenery. I like to mix up my treadmill runs by varying the pace and incline-a good show helps too.

On this “Run with It” round up we’re sharing treadmill workouts and tips to help you stay sane.

My 30 minute workout will take you through two tough 10K and 5K paced intervals, with a recovery jog and then two 5 minute segments at half marathon pace. The whole workout is a bit like a tempo workout, and your heart rate will be somewhat similar, but there’s enough variation to keep things interesting.
